Tag Archives: Battletoads

Battletoads releases on August 20th, PC system requirements revealed

Microsoft has announced that Battletoads will officially release on August 20th. The game will be available on both Windows Store and Steam, and you can find below a new trailer for it. Moreover, Microsoft has also revealed the game’s official PC system requirements. Continue reading Battletoads releases on August 20th, PC system requirements revealed

E3 2019 Trailers for 12 Minutes, Battletoads, Wasteland 3, Age of Empires II DE, LEGO Star Wars The Skywalker Saga & Borderlands 3

Now as you may have guessed, a lot of E3 2019 trailers got released this past hour. As such, we’ve decided to collect them all in one big article (I know, I know, it’s not fair as some other games had dedicated articles but still). Continue reading E3 2019 Trailers for 12 Minutes, Battletoads, Wasteland 3, Age of Empires II DE, LEGO Star Wars The Skywalker Saga & Borderlands 3